From f63bea84e75d75bcd7c2f05eea859bde101e1651 Mon Sep 17 00:00:00 2001 From: Igor Berdichevskiy Date: Fri, 27 Aug 2021 13:33:26 +0300 Subject: [PATCH] 1.0.0 (#2) * Fix component check * Add update server [close #1] --- language/en-GB/en-GB.plg_authentication_radicalmart.ini | 2 +- .../en-GB/en-GB.plg_authentication_radicalmart.sys.ini | 2 +- language/ru-RU/ru-RU.plg_authentication_radicalmart.ini | 2 +- .../ru-RU/ru-RU.plg_authentication_radicalmart.sys.ini | 2 +- radicalmart.php | 6 ++---- radicalmart.xml | 7 ++++++- script.php | 2 +- 7 files changed, 13 insertions(+), 10 deletions(-) diff --git a/language/en-GB/en-GB.plg_authentication_radicalmart.ini b/language/en-GB/en-GB.plg_authentication_radicalmart.ini index a840ad6..8076e7b 100644 --- a/language/en-GB/en-GB.plg_authentication_radicalmart.ini +++ b/language/en-GB/en-GB.plg_authentication_radicalmart.ini @@ -1,6 +1,6 @@ ; @package RadicalMart Package ; @subpackage plg_authentication_radicalmart -; @version 0.2.0 +; @version 1.0.0 ; @author Delo Design - delo-design.ru ; @copyright Copyright (c) 2021 Delo Design. All rights reserved. ; @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html diff --git a/language/en-GB/en-GB.plg_authentication_radicalmart.sys.ini b/language/en-GB/en-GB.plg_authentication_radicalmart.sys.ini index a840ad6..8076e7b 100644 --- a/language/en-GB/en-GB.plg_authentication_radicalmart.sys.ini +++ b/language/en-GB/en-GB.plg_authentication_radicalmart.sys.ini @@ -1,6 +1,6 @@ ; @package RadicalMart Package ; @subpackage plg_authentication_radicalmart -; @version 0.2.0 +; @version 1.0.0 ; @author Delo Design - delo-design.ru ; @copyright Copyright (c) 2021 Delo Design. All rights reserved. ; @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html diff --git a/language/ru-RU/ru-RU.plg_authentication_radicalmart.ini b/language/ru-RU/ru-RU.plg_authentication_radicalmart.ini index cbfc6c3..aae252c 100644 --- a/language/ru-RU/ru-RU.plg_authentication_radicalmart.ini +++ b/language/ru-RU/ru-RU.plg_authentication_radicalmart.ini @@ -1,6 +1,6 @@ ; @package RadicalMart Package ; @subpackage plg_authentication_radicalmart -; @version 0.2.0 +; @version 1.0.0 ; @author Delo Design - delo-design.ru ; @copyright Copyright (c) 2021 Delo Design. All rights reserved. ; @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html diff --git a/language/ru-RU/ru-RU.plg_authentication_radicalmart.sys.ini b/language/ru-RU/ru-RU.plg_authentication_radicalmart.sys.ini index cbfc6c3..aae252c 100644 --- a/language/ru-RU/ru-RU.plg_authentication_radicalmart.sys.ini +++ b/language/ru-RU/ru-RU.plg_authentication_radicalmart.sys.ini @@ -1,6 +1,6 @@ ; @package RadicalMart Package ; @subpackage plg_authentication_radicalmart -; @version 0.2.0 +; @version 1.0.0 ; @author Delo Design - delo-design.ru ; @copyright Copyright (c) 2021 Delo Design. All rights reserved. ; @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html diff --git a/radicalmart.php b/radicalmart.php index b832484..13da2c9 100644 --- a/radicalmart.php +++ b/radicalmart.php @@ -2,7 +2,7 @@ /* * @package RadicalMart Express Package * @subpackage plg_button_radicalmart_express - * @version 0.2.0 + * @version 1.0.0 * @author Delo Design - delo-design.ru * @copyright Copyright (c) 2021 Delo Design. All rights reserved. * @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html @@ -68,7 +68,7 @@ public function onUserAuthenticate(&$credentials, $options, &$response) try { - if (ComponentHelper::getComponent('com_radicalmart_express')) + if (!empty(ComponentHelper::getComponent('com_radicalmart_express')->id)) { JLoader::register('RadicalMartHelperUser', JPATH_ADMINISTRATOR . '/components/com_radicalmart_express/helpers/user.php'); @@ -84,8 +84,6 @@ public function onUserAuthenticate(&$credentials, $options, &$response) } // Prepare data - JLoader::register('RadicalMartHelperUser', - JPATH_ADMINISTRATOR . '/components/com_radicalmart_express/helpers/user.php'); $data = array( 'username' => $credentials['username'], 'email' => $credentials['username'], diff --git a/radicalmart.xml b/radicalmart.xml index 23dd5a1..ae7c9c9 100644 --- a/radicalmart.xml +++ b/radicalmart.xml @@ -7,7 +7,7 @@ https://www.gnu.org/copyleft/gpl.html GNU/GPL boss@delo-design.ru https://delo-design.ru - 0.2.0 + 1.0.0 PLG_AUTHENTICATION_RADICALMART_DESCRIPTION script.php @@ -19,4 +19,9 @@ radicalmart.php + + + https://radicalmart.ru/update?element=plg_authentication_radicalmart + + \ No newline at end of file diff --git a/script.php b/script.php index 7be6e90..06af99b 100644 --- a/script.php +++ b/script.php @@ -2,7 +2,7 @@ /* * @package RadicalMart Package * @subpackage plg_pagecache_radicalmart - * @version 0.2.0 + * @version 1.0.0 * @author Delo Design - delo-design.ru * @copyright Copyright (c) 2021 Delo Design. All rights reserved. * @license GNU/GPL license: https://www.gnu.org/copyleft/gpl.html